This restaurant very closely reminded me of Katsu shops in Japan. The katsu was very well cooked, the panko was not over-cooked or over-fried and perfectly crispy. The meats had a good distribution of fat which improved taste and chewability. Another thing that reminded me of Japan was the high quality rice that was used. This is something that is often overlooked when eating at restaurants in America as we are used to the generic rice used at most restaurants. Next time you are here, take a close look at the grains of rice and pay attention to texture and taste.
I highly recommend this restaurant for its focus on Katsu and as an authentic experience of a Japanese katsu restaurant. The only difference is that the ingredient quality in Japan on another level and that is the only area that this restaurant needs to improve if it wanted to be perfect. Read moreI saw some 4-star reviews commenting on the lack of service. I have no idea what they’re talking about, as it was some of the best service I’ve ever received.
I entered the restaurant at 1pm on a Sunday and was immediately seated. A minute later, they took my order as they brought me my water. The food came out 5-10 minutes later, which was surprising given that the restaurant seemed to be at ~90% capacity.
2 different servers checked in on me within 5 minutes of receiving my food to make sure I was good (I was doing great, that katsu & rice are amazing).
I finished my food and pushed the plate away a bit, a server immediately saw and asked if I was ready to pay.
From walking in to walking out, 30 minutes total. I was super surprised at how fast, kind, and efficient the service was.
Also a very nice ambience! Reminded me of a similar katsu place I ate at once in Kyoto.
